Series: | GL-P |
Packaging: | Tray |
Part Status: | Active |
Memory Type: | Non-Volatile |
Memory Format: | FLASH |
Technology: | FLASH - NOR |
Memory Size: | 256Mb (32M x 8) |
Write Cycle Time - Word, Page: | 90ns |
Access Time: | 90ns |
Memory Interface: | Parallel |
Voltage - Supply: | 3 V ~ 3.6 V |
Operating Temperature: | 0°C ~ 85°C (TA) |
Mounting Type: | Surface Mount |
Package / Case: | 56-TFSOP (0.724", 18.40mm Width) |
Supplier Device Package: | 56-TSOP |

Working Principle
The S29GL256P90TFCR20 is a non-volatile flash memory device, which means that data is stored permanently in the memory. In this kind of memory, data is stored in an array of memory cells and these cells can be read from and written to via a controlled current. This means that the device is able to store data even when the power is switched off.
